An interview with Kitchener based activist Julian Ichim on the summer-long tent city which was launched in response to the ongoing housing and fentanyl poisoning crises in Waterloo region.
We discuss the idea of drugs as a social issue, police harassment and dig for some roots of the issues. Julian highlights the activities of the âOverdose Prevention Teamâ as the push for a safe injection site intensifies in town.
